Visa Enables Crypto Withdrawals on Debit Cards in 145 Countries

MetaMask users can now sell crypto directly to a Visa card, eliminating the need for centralized exchanges.

Visa is enhancing cryptocurrency adoption by enabling a new method to convert crypto to fiat currencies without using centralized exchanges. In partnership with Web3 infrastructure provider Transak, Visa has introduced cryptocurrency withdrawals and payments through Visa Direct.

This integration allows users to withdraw c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in, directly from wallets like MetaMask to a Visa debit card. This feature is available immediately, enabling users to exchange crypto for fiat and pay at 130 million merchant locations that accept Visa.

“By enabling real-time card withdrawals through Visa Direct, Transak is delivering a faster, simpler, and more connected experience for its users,” said Visa Direct’s North America Head Yanilsa Gonzalez-Ore. This partnership allows users from 145 countries to convert over 40 cryptocurrencies to fiat without relying on centralized exchanges. Supported countries include Cyprus, Malta, Singapore, Turkey, Portugal, and the UAE.

“This is a major step towards mainstream acceptance and utilization of cryptocurrencies,” noted Transak’s marketing head Harshit Gangwar. The integration benefits users of decentralized platforms and wallets like MetaMask, enhancing the usability of their digital assets.
